Tridactyl In Webster's Dictionary

\Tri*dac"tyl\ Tridactyle \Tri*dac"tyle\, a. [Gr. ?: ? (see {Tri-}) + ? digit: cf. F. tridactyle.] (Biol.) Having three fingers or toes, or composed of three movable parts attached to a common base.
